About Amadeus

Amadeus operates one of the world's most extensive electronic marketplaces. It enables travel agents and travel service providers to market and sell travel, to corporate and consumer end-users, in over 200* markets around the world.

In addition, their modular technology is used by over 100 airlines, and other travel service providers, to optimize their internal operational requirements.

The core of their business is to serve many different companies - whether airlines, travel agents, hotel operators or car rental firms. The rapid expansion of this business has helped them establish a reputation as the fastest growing and most widely used global distribution system (GDS).

Amadeus provides the technology that moves the travel industry.

A brief history of Amadeus

  • founded in 1987; fully operational since 1992
  • publicly listed company since 1999
  • three founder airline shareholders currently hold 59.92% of the company: Air France (23.36%), Iberia (18.28%) and Lufthansa (18.28%)
  • remaining shares held publicly

Travel agents - core users of the Amadeus reservation system

Amadeus provides a comprehensive range of services to travel agency subscribers. Over 155,000 travel agency terminals connect to Amadeus.

Airline users

Amadeus is the only GDS to offer airlines the ability to use the their distribution system, not just for distribution, but also for making bookings at the airline's airport ticket offices (ATOs) and city ticket offices (CTOs).

  • over 100 airline customers with more than 70,000 Amadeus terminals installed

They are truly global

  • they lead the market in Western Europe and Latin America
  • They are in the process of consolidating their positions in the US, Africa and Asia Pacific regions
  • Amadeus recently acquired Vacation.com (largest US marketing network for leisure travel)
  • they have the most extensive international distribution network worldwide
  • more international bookings are made through Amadeus than through any other system

Wide range of solutions and technology

* As of 2001, Amadeus calculates its worldwide presence based on the list of territories published by the International Organization for Standardization. Accordingly the total number of markets served by Amadeus amounts to 198 at 31 December 2000, of which 167 have both travel agencies and airline sales offices while 31 have only airline sales offices.
